  2. The Last Place on Earth is a 1985 Central Television seven-part serial, written by Trevor Griffiths based on the book Scott and Amundsen by Roland Huntford. The book is an exploration of the expeditions of Captain Robert F. Scott (played by Martin Shaw ) and his Norwegian rival in polar exploration, Roald Amundsen (played by Sverre Anker Ousdal ...
